AWF Set To Hold A Reading Of TO KILL A MOCKINGBIRD On 9/28

By:

This month, the Aspen Writers' Foundation (AWF) launches the second Big Read Roaring Fork Valley. The Big Read is designed to restore reading to the center of American culture. This community-based reading campaign aims to get as many people as possible in a given area reading and talking about the same book at the same time. Over the next two months the AWF is inviting the entire Roaring Fork Valley to join in reading and celebrating To Kill A Mockingbird by Harper Lee

On Monday, September 28th at 7:30pm, the AWF, in partnership with Theatre Aspen and The Wheeler Opera House, presents the theatrical adaptation of this great American novel by the Montana Repertory Theatre at the Wheeler Opera House. The entire community is invited to witness the colorful characters of To Kill A Mockingbird come to life as one of the oldest and most respected touring companies in the country brings a compelling performance of this classic American novel to Aspen. Refreshments, free copies of the book, readers' guides, and Big Read community calendars will be available following the performance.

Tickets: $25-$30, available through the Wheeler Opera House, 970.920.5770 or aspenshowtickets.com. Heavily discounted group sales are available by calling the AWF at 970.925.3122.

The Big Read is an initiative of the National Endowment for the Arts in partnership with the Institute of Museum and Library Services and in cooperation with Arts Midwest. Support for The Big Read is provided by the W.K. Kellogg Foundation. The Big Read Roaring Fork Valley is also supported, in part, by grants from Diane Goldberg Hunckler, and Dennis Vaughn and his wife Linda in memory of Linda Vaughn Bennion.
